What is fast battery charging?
Fast Charging is a term frequently used to market chargers and devices capable of charging faster than the current charging standard (5 Watts). Though there are multiple technologies that enable these fast charging speeds, there is no industry-standard language around them.

Is fast charger AC or DC?
DC charging
DC charging, or so-called fast charging, is done using a DC charging station, which can change the alternating current (AC) to direct current (DC), it then “bypasses” the on-board charger of the electric car and sends this direct current via Battery Management System (BMS) to the battery, as instructed by the vehicle’s …
Does heat reduce battery life?
It is no secret that automotive battery performance and lifespan are greatly affected by temperature. Most people believe cold weather is what kills the battery, but it is hot weather that shortens the lifespan of the battery. When the battery gets cold, the chemical reactions are slowed.
What percent should you charge your phone?
Android phone manufacturers, including Samsung, say the same. “Do not leave your phone connected to the charger for long periods of time or overnight.” Huawei says, “Keeping your battery level as close to the middle (30% to 70%) as possible can effectively prolong the battery life.”
Is 18W fast charging good?
Quick Charge 3.0 dynamically boosts voltage from 3.2V to 20V, though peak power for both standards is 18W. That means, theoretically, phones with a 3,500mAh to 4,500mAh capacity can gain about 80 percent charge in just 35 minutes when the battery is depleted.
What is 10W fast charging?
The most common solution is the 5V/2A charging which delivers 10W of power and pretty much every phone other there supports this charging rate. The real quick charging starts from there and up. Smartphones utilizing Qualcomm chipsets can make use of Qualcomm’s QuickCharge protocol.
Does it cost money to charge a Tesla?
If you purchase the 2021 Standard Range Model 3, you can expect to pay about $7.65 to fully charge the battery. That brings the cost per mile to about $0.03, or $2.91 per 100 miles. To completely charge the 2021 Long Range and Performance models, it would cost $12.54.
